Output 61743330efa9a75099b45473b7170c7ec76cc99e0cfa5a92f001ea88996a75fe:13

value
44520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d65a2f1f90daaa2e6d84feea507bd3c8bab46b1 OP_EQUALVERIFY OP_CHECKSIG
address
1Dte2spfhhpBr1EDaqa6qCQNiDuUKkThMm
transaction
61743330efa9a75099b45473b7170c7ec76cc99e0cfa5a92f001ea88996a75fe
spent
true